Altcoin Futures Volume Signaling A Move

The altcoin market is drawing increased attention after 24H futures trading volume surpassed that of Bitcoin and Ethereum, according to the latest market data. This shift highlights a surge in speculative activity, with investors pouring liquidity into higher-risk assets. Analyst Ted Pillows explains that despite last week’s sharp flush-out, which cleared overleveraged positions across multiple altcoins, retail traders have quickly returned to the market, embracing what he calls a “full degen mode” approach.

Altcoin 24H volume surpasses BTC and ETH | Source: Ted Pillows
Altcoin 24H volume surpasses BTC and ETH | Source: Ted Pillows

This dynamic raises both opportunities and risks. Elevated trading activity in altcoin derivatives reflects renewed appetite for risk-taking, signaling that investor sentiment has not been entirely derailed by recent volatility.

On the other hand, history shows that when altcoin futures volumes climb disproportionately compared to BTC and ETH, the market often faces heightened liquidation risk. Leveraged bets amplify price swings, and even small corrections can cascade into massive liquidations, dragging prices lower across the board.

Whether it materializes as a breakout to new highs or another round of forced liquidations depends largely on Bitcoin’s ability to stabilize and broader macroeconomic conditions. For now, the message is clear: retail enthusiasm has returned, volumes are rising, and altcoins are once again the focal point of speculative trading. While this sets the stage for explosive price action, it also reinforces the need for caution as the risk of another major liquidation event looms.

Altcoin Market Consolidates

The chart of the total crypto market cap excluding the top 10 coins shows that altcoins continue to trade in a decisive zone around $303B. After several months of consolidation, the market cap has formed a base above the $250B region, a level that acted as resistance in 2023 and now serves as support. This structural shift suggests that altcoins are maintaining strength despite recent volatility in Bitcoin and Ethereum.

The moving averages highlight the trend more clearly: the 50-week SMA remains above the 200-week SMA, keeping a long-term bullish bias intact. However, the market has struggled to reclaim the $400B mark, a key resistance area tested multiple times since early 2024. Each rejection at this level has led to sharp retracements, signaling the importance of $400B as a breakout threshold for the next altseason.

Current price action shows tightening around the 50- and 100-week SMAs, reflecting indecision but also the potential for a strong move once momentum returns. A sustained close above $320B could signal renewed bullish momentum, while a breakdown below $280B may confirm deeper corrections.

Beyond the 'Kimchi Premium': Institutional Transformation in Korea

South Korea's crypto landscape is moving beyond the volatile "Kimchi Premium" era driven by retail speculation, according to Andrew Park, CEO of Factblock. Park, who organizes Korea Blockchain Week, notes a significant shift in the nature of international inquiries. Global institutions are now focusing on market access, asset custody, tokenization, stablecoins, and regulatory compliance, rather than just token listings and prices. This institutionalization is being built through foundational, "unsexy" back-office work: developing corporate crypto accounts, legal finality for settlements, accounting standards, and custody solutions. Key regulatory steps include the Financial Services Commission's framework for corporate virtual asset accounts and National Assembly amendments to laws governing tokenized securities and real-world assets. Park, with a traditional finance background, bridges the perspectives of Wall Street and Web3. He explains that traditional banks prioritize managing edge-case failures and regulatory reporting, which crypto-native firms sometimes misunderstand. Conversely, traditional financiers often overlook blockchain's systemic utility for 24/7 global settlement and programmable money. Looking ahead, Park sees South Korea's next frontier at the intersection of AI and programmable blockchain infrastructure. He is particularly interested in the infrastructure needed for a "machine-to-machine" economy, where AI agents could autonomously conduct micropayments and transactions using on-chain settlement mechanisms—a concept already being explored in pilot projects by the Bank of Korea. With its advanced digital infrastructure and investments in both Web3 and AI, South Korea is uniquely positioned to develop this future.

Telegram Introduces WEB-Proxy Technology: Traffic Camouflaged as Regular Website Visits

Telegram has introduced an experimental WEB-proxy technology, unveiled on August 21, 2026, designed to bypass blocking by disguising messenger traffic as regular, encrypted website visits. This new method in Telegram Desktop routes MTProxy data through a WebView transport using HTTPS or WebSocket, making the data stream indistinguishable from legitimate web browsing and offering a new avenue for accessing the service under restrictions. The core innovation is a multiplexed stream sent through the app's built-in browser engine. It maintains MTProxy's encryption but sends all data via a single WebView session. Special frame types (OPEN, DATA, WINDOW, CLOSE) package multiple Telegram connections into one secure channel that appears as a standard webpage load. A server-side relay receives this stream, separates it into individual connections for the MTProxy without decrypting content or knowing final destinations, preserving privacy. The WEB-proxy operates on a regular HTTPS domain that simultaneously hosts a public website. The proxy bridge page activates only with a specific parameter derived from the configuration; all other requests receive the standard homepage, providing reliable cover. Connection links use formats like https://t.me/webproxy?server=... or tg://webproxy, with port 443 and HTTPS being mandatory. Currently a proof-of-concept, the project includes a desktop implementation, an experimental Android client, and plans for iOS support. It represents a shift towards more sophisticated integration with legitimate web infrastructure, leveraging standard browser mechanisms to complicate traffic filtering. The practical value will depend on its resilience to adaptive traffic analysis and scalability. This approach structurally echoes earlier techniques like domain fronting, highlighting the cyclical nature of the struggle between censorship and circumvention technologies.

What is $BITCOIN

D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N): A Comprehensive Analysis Introduction to D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) is a blockchain-based project operating on the Solana network, which aims to combine the characteristics of traditional precious metals with the innovation of decentralized technologies. While it shares a name with Bitcoin, often referred to as “digital gold” due to its perception as a store of value, DIGITAL GOLD is a separate token designed to create a unique ecosystem within the Web3 landscape. Its goal is to position itself as a viable alternative digital asset, although specifics regarding its applications and functionalities are still developing. What is D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N)? D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) is a cryptocurrency token explicitly designed for use on the Solana blockchain. In contrast to Bitcoin, which provides a widely recognized value storage role, this token appears to focus on broader applications and characteristics. Notable aspects include: Blockchain Infrastructure: The token is built on the Solana blockchain, known for its capacity to handle high-speed and low-cost transactions. Supply Dynamics: DIGITAL GOLD has a maximum supply capped at 100 quadrillion tokens (100P $BITCOIN), although details regarding its circulating supply are currently undisclosed. Utility: While precise functionalities are not explicitly outlined, there are indications that the token could be utilized for various applications, potentially involving decentralized applications (dApps) or asset tokenization strategies. Who is the Creator of D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N)? At present, the identity of the creators and development team behind D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) remains unknown. This situation is typical among many innovative projects within the blockchain space, particularly those aligning with decentralized finance and meme coin phenomena. While such anonymity may foster a community-driven culture, it intensifies concerns about governance and accountability. Who are the Investors of D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N)? The available information indicates that D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) does not have any known institutional backers or prominent venture capital investments. The project seems to operate on a peer-to-peer model focused on community support and adoption rather than traditional funding routes. Its activity and liquidity are primarily situated on decentralized exchanges (DEXs), such as PumpSwap, rather than established centralized trading platforms, further highlighting its grassroots approach. How D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) Works The operational mechanics of D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) can be elaborated on based on its blockchain design and network attributes: Consensus Mechanism: By leveraging Solana’s unique proof-of-history (PoH) combined with a proof-of-stake (PoS) model, the project ensures efficient transaction validation contributing to the network's high performance. Tokenomics: While specific deflationary mechanisms have not been extensively detailed, the vast maximum token supply implies that it may cater to microtransactions or niche use cases that are still to be defined. Interoperability: There exists the potential for integration with Solana’s broader ecosystem, including various dec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ms. However, the details regarding specific integrations remain unspecified. Timeline of Key Events Here is a timeline that highlights significant milestones concerning D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N): 2023: The initial deployment of the token occurs on the Solana blockchain, marked by its contract address. 2024: DIGITAL GOLD gains visibility as it becomes available for trading on decentralized exchanges like PumpSwap, allowing users to trade it against SOL. 2025: The project witnesses sporadic trading activity and potential interest in community-led engagements, although no noteworthy partnerships or technical advancements have been documented as of yet. Critical Analysis Strengths Scalability: The underlying Solana infrastructure supports high transaction volumes, which could enhance the utility of $BITCOIN in various transaction scenarios. Accessibility: The potential low trading price per token could attract retail investors, facilitating wider participation due to fractional ownership opportunities. Risks Lack of Transparency: The absence of publicly known backers, developers, or an audit process may yield skepticism regarding the project's sustainability and trustworthiness. Market Volatility: The trading activity is heavily reliant on speculative behavior, which can result in significant price volatility and uncertainty for investors. Conclusion DIGITAL GOLD ($BITCOIN) emerges as an intriguing yet ambiguous project within the rapidly evolving Solana ecosystem. While it attempts to leverage the “digital gold” narrative, its departure from Bitcoin's established role as a store of value underscores the need for a clearer differentiation of its intended utility and governance structure. Future acceptance and adoption will likely depend on addressing the current opacity and defining its operational and economic strategies more explicitly.
